OSHKOSH, Wis. - The Carroll University women's volleyball team went 0-2 in the Politos Classic at the University of Wisconsin-Oshkosh on Saturday.
Carroll, 1-7 overall, dropped its opening dual to Wisconsin Lutheran College in five sets 25-19, 19-25, 25-19, 25-27, 15-12 and fell to St. Norbert College 25-16, 25-9, 25-21 in the finale.
DUAL 1
Katie Jensen registered 12 kills, 10 digs, five blocks and one assist in the inspired, hard-fought opener against Wisconsin Lutheran.
Peyton Frost contributed 10 kills and two blocks with
Ashley Konecki chipping in eight kills, five blocks and a service ace.
Emily Schliesman had 24 digs and 39 assists.
Kloe Longtin added 22 digs, three aces and three assists.
The Pioneers, who finished with 46 kills, 44 assists, 91 digs, nine blocks and eight aces, registered 14 kills with just five errors in winning both the second and third games.
DUAL 2
Jensen contributed six kills, six digs and a block versus St. Norbert.
Frost followed with four kills and Konecki collected three kills for the Pioneers, who finished with 19 kills, 41 digs, 18 assists, three blocks and three service aces.
Cathleen Flannery had nine digs and two aces with Schliesman adding nine assists.
